[PATCH 13/59] drm/ttm: split the mm manager init code (v2)
Christian König
christian.koenig at amd.com
Tue Aug 4 13:08:11 UTC 2020
Am 04.08.20 um 13:07 schrieb Christian König:
> Am 04.08.20 um 04:55 schrieb Dave Airlie:
>> From: Dave Airlie <airlied at redhat.com>
>>
>> This will allow the driver to control the ordering here better.
>>
>> Eventually the old path will be removed.
>>
>> v2: add docs for new APIs.
>> rename new path to ttm_mem_type_manager_init/set_used(for now)
>>
>> Signed-off-by: Dave Airlie <airlied at redhat.com>
>
> Reviewed-by: Christian König <christian.koenig at amd.com>
BTW: I've just noticed that you (most likely) accidentally added a tab
after every use of ttm_mem_type_manager_set_used() in the follow up patches.
Not sure where this is coming from, but it annoys checkpatch quite a bit :)
